Closed MadhulikaTanuboddi closed 3 years ago
Since Sep 20, all the apps are failing on all Mac builds (R3.4, 3.5, 3.6, 4.0, 4.1) consistently (with a timeout). This is because the shinyjster tests are specifically failing on firefox browser.
Sample log from https://pipelines.actions.githubusercontent.com/7D7nBlSdDrw0I67fqFPzdTKzjkyxAMv8ENWHMkl5rWao4xTGuf/_apis/pipelines/1/runs/3429/signedlogcontent/24?urlExpires=2021-09-29T00%3A55%3A22.8129672Z&urlSigningMethod=HMACV1&urlSignature=%2BApgZ7WBbEcaNlqDWZvjZImPlnR5Nie08oNIQ%2BdNr%2B0%3D
2021-09-28T12:17:09.0990950Z Loading required package: shiny 2021-09-28T12:17:09.1239560Z shinyjster - starting app: 134-async-hold-timers 2021-09-28T12:17:09.2435120Z 2021-09-28T12:17:09.2436810Z Listening on http://127.0.0.1:48897 2021-09-28T12:17:09.7216080Z Running java -jar \ 2021-09-28T12:17:09.7217080Z /Users/runner/work/_temp/Library/shinyjster/selenium/selenium.jar firefox \ 2021-09-28T12:17:09.7218530Z 1200x1200 'http://127.0.0.1:48897/?shinyjster=1' 120 -headless 2021-09-28T12:17:32.5008290Z pxjava - Exception in thread "main" java.lang.reflect.InvocationTargetException 2021-09-28T12:17:32.5010840Z pxjava - at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method) 2021-09-28T12:17:32.5013660Z pxjava - at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62) 2021-09-28T12:17:32.5016950Z pxjava - at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45) 2021-09-28T12:17:32.5019560Z pxjava - at java.lang.reflect.Constructor.newInstance(Constructor.java:423) 2021-09-28T12:17:32.5021390Z pxjava - at com.rstudio.seleniumRunner.MainKt.main(Main.kt:73) 2021-09-28T12:17:32.5024170Z pxjava - Caused by: org.openqa.selenium.WebDriverException: java.net.ConnectException: Failed to connect to localhost/0:0:0:0:0:0:0:1:2571 2021-09-28T12:17:32.5027030Z pxjava - Build info: version: 'unknown', revision: 'unknown', time: 'unknown' 2021-09-28T12:17:32.5029710Z pxjava - System info: host: 'Mac-1632816324812.local', ip: '10.79.1.174', os.name: 'Mac OS X', os.arch: 'x86_64', os.version: '10.15.7', java.version: '1.8.0_302' 2021-09-28T12:17:32.5031840Z pxjava - Driver info: driver.version: FirefoxDriver 2021-09-28T12:17:32.5034830Z pxjava - at org.openqa.selenium.remote.service.DriverCommandExecutor.execute(DriverCommandExecutor.java:92) 2021-09-28T12:17:32.5037730Z pxjava - at org.openqa.selenium.remote.RemoteWebDriver.execute(RemoteWebDriver.java:552) 2021-09-28T12:17:32.5040340Z pxjava - at org.openqa.selenium.remote.RemoteWebDriver.startSession(RemoteWebDriver.java:213) 2021-09-28T12:17:32.5042800Z pxjava - at org.openqa.selenium.remote.RemoteWebDriver.<init>(RemoteWebDriver.java:131) 2021-09-28T12:17:32.5044980Z pxjava - at org.openqa.selenium.firefox.FirefoxDriver.<init>(FirefoxDriver.java:147) 2021-09-28T12:17:32.5046340Z pxjava - ... 5 more 2021-09-28T12:17:32.5047720Z pxjava - Caused by: java.net.ConnectException: Failed to connect to localhost/0:0:0:0:0:0:0:1:2571 2021-09-28T12:17:32.5049910Z pxjava - at okhttp3.internal.connection.RealConnection.connectSocket(RealConnection.java:247) 2021-09-28T12:17:32.5052460Z pxjava - at okhttp3.internal.connection.RealConnection.connect(RealConnection.java:165) 2021-09-28T12:17:32.5055560Z pxjava - at okhttp3.internal.connection.StreamAllocation.findConnection(StreamAllocation.java:257) 2021-09-28T12:17:32.5058640Z pxjava - at okhttp3.internal.connection.StreamAllocation.findHealthyConnection(StreamAllocation.java:135) 2021-09-28T12:17:32.5061680Z pxjava - at okhttp3.internal.connection.StreamAllocation.newStream(StreamAllocation.java:114) 2021-09-28T12:17:32.5064410Z pxjava - at okhttp3.internal.connection.ConnectInterceptor.intercept(ConnectInterceptor.java:42) 2021-09-28T12:17:32.5067080Z pxjava - at okhttp3.internal.http.RealInterceptorChain.proceed(RealInterceptorChain.java:147) 2021-09-28T12:17:32.5069660Z pxjava - at okhttp3.internal.http.RealInterceptorChain.proceed(RealInterceptorChain.java:121) 2021-09-28T12:17:32.5072130Z pxjava - at okhttp3.internal.cache.CacheInterceptor.intercept(CacheInterceptor.java:93) 2021-09-28T12:17:32.5074640Z pxjava - at okhttp3.internal.http.RealInterceptorChain.proceed(RealInterceptorChain.java:147) 2021-09-28T12:17:32.5077930Z pxjava - at okhttp3.internal.http.RealInterceptorChain.proceed(RealInterceptorChain.java:121) 2021-09-28T12:17:32.5080580Z pxjava - at okhttp3.internal.http.BridgeInterceptor.intercept(BridgeInterceptor.java:93) 2021-09-28T12:17:32.5083570Z pxjava - at okhttp3.internal.http.RealInterceptorChain.proceed(RealInterceptorChain.java:147) 2021-09-28T12:17:32.5088400Z pxjava - at okhttp3.internal.http.RetryAndFollowUpInterceptor.intercept(RetryAndFollowUpInterceptor.java:126) 2021-09-28T12:17:32.5092430Z pxjava - at okhttp3.internal.http.RealInterceptorChain.proceed(RealInterceptorChain.java:147) 2021-09-28T12:17:32.5095050Z pxjava - at okhttp3.internal.http.RealInterceptorChain.proceed(RealInterceptorChain.java:121) 2021-09-28T12:17:32.5097470Z pxjava - at okhttp3.RealCall.getResponseWithInterceptorChain(RealCall.java:200) 2021-09-28T12:17:32.5099260Z pxjava - at okhttp3.RealCall.execute(RealCall.java:77) 2021-09-28T12:17:32.5101330Z pxjava - at org.openqa.selenium.remote.internal.OkHttpClient.execute(OkHttpClient.java:103) 2021-09-28T12:17:32.5104120Z pxjava - at org.openqa.selenium.remote.ProtocolHandshake.createSession(ProtocolHandshake.java:105) 2021-09-28T12:17:32.5108420Z pxjava - at org.openqa.selenium.remote.ProtocolHandshake.createSession(ProtocolHandshake.java:74) 2021-09-28T12:17:32.5111370Z pxjava - at org.openqa.selenium.remote.HttpCommandExecutor.execute(HttpCommandExecutor.java:136) 2021-09-28T12:17:32.5114450Z pxjava - at org.openqa.selenium.remote.service.DriverCommandExecutor.execute(DriverCommandExecutor.java:83) 2021-09-28T12:17:32.5116390Z pxjava - ... 9 more 2021-09-28T12:17:32.5117760Z pxjava - Caused by: java.net.ConnectException: Connection refused (Connection refused) 2021-09-28T12:17:32.5119470Z pxjava - at java.net.PlainSocketImpl.socketConnect(Native Method) 2021-09-28T12:17:32.5121550Z pxjava - at java.net.AbstractPlainSocketImpl.doConnect(AbstractPlainSocketImpl.java:350) 2021-09-28T12:17:32.5124070Z pxjava - at java.net.AbstractPlainSocketImpl.connectToAddress(AbstractPlainSocketImpl.java:206) 2021-09-28T12:17:32.5126530Z pxjava - at java.net.AbstractPlainSocketImpl.connect(AbstractPlainSocketImpl.java:188) 2021-09-28T12:17:32.5128510Z pxjava - at java.net.SocksSocketImpl.connect(SocksSocketImpl.java:392) 2021-09-28T12:17:32.5130010Z pxjava - at java.net.Socket.connect(Socket.java:607) 2021-09-28T12:17:32.5131790Z pxjava - at okhttp3.internal.platform.Platform.connectSocket(Platform.java:129) 2021-09-28T12:17:32.5134510Z pxjava - at okhttp3.internal.connection.RealConnection.connectSocket(RealConnection.java:245) 2021-09-28T12:17:32.5136160Z pxjava - ... 31 more 2021-09-28T12:17:32.5137080Z pxjava - Selenium Processx closed
Temporarily fixed by https://github.com/rstudio/shinycoreci-apps/issues/186
Since Sep 20, all the apps are failing on all Mac builds (R3.4, 3.5, 3.6, 4.0, 4.1) consistently (with a timeout). This is because the shinyjster tests are specifically failing on firefox browser.
Sample log from https://pipelines.actions.githubusercontent.com/7D7nBlSdDrw0I67fqFPzdTKzjkyxAMv8ENWHMkl5rWao4xTGuf/_apis/pipelines/1/runs/3429/signedlogcontent/24?urlExpires=2021-09-29T00%3A55%3A22.8129672Z&urlSigningMethod=HMACV1&urlSignature=%2BApgZ7WBbEcaNlqDWZvjZImPlnR5Nie08oNIQ%2BdNr%2B0%3D